Allah chooses a prophet based on His divine wisdom and knowledge. A prophet is typically someone of moral integrity, honesty, and deep spiritual connection. They are chosen not by their own merit but by divine selection to convey Allah's message and guidance to humanity. The chosen individual is then given revelations through the angel Gabriel, providing them with the knowledge and messages they need to fulfill their prophetic mission.
